Loading...
Pages: 1 [2]   Go Down
Author Topic: Circuito di switch alimentazione arduino  (Read 733 times)
0 Members and 1 Guest are viewing this topic.
Rome (Italy)
Offline Offline
Tesla Member
***
Karma: 74
Posts: 7379
"Il Vero Programmatore ha imparato il C sul K&R, qualunque altro testo è inutile e deviante."
View Profile
WWW
 Bigger Bigger  Smaller Smaller  Reset Reset

Tieni presente che la tensione minima ufficiale di funzionamento del micro è 4,5V,

4.5V è la tensione minima alla quale è garantito il funzionamento a 20 MHz, l'ATmega328 può lavorare con una tensione minima di 1.8V con il clock a 4MHz, con il clock a 16 MHz la tensione minima è ~4.3V.
Logged


Lamezia Terme
Offline Offline
Shannon Member
****
Karma: 386
Posts: 10281
Le domande di chi vuol imparare rappresentano la sua sete di sapere
View Profile
WWW
 Bigger Bigger  Smaller Smaller  Reset Reset

Ovviamente mi riferivo al 328 "quarzato", visto che parliamo di uno stand-alone tipo Arduino. Comunque a pag. 308 del datasheet c'è il grafico delle alimentazioni da cui si evince che effettivamente 4,5V è la tensione minima a 20MHz, mentre a 16Mhz effettivamente è inferiore. Prima parlavo di tensione "ufficiale", io stesso ho appurato che alcuni 328P a 16MHz arrivano anche a meno di 4V senza problemi, diciamo che certamente non incontrerà alcuna difficoltà. smiley
Logged

Guida alla programmazione ISP e seriale dei micro ATMEL (Caricare bootloader e sketch):
http://www.michelemenniti.it/Arduino_burn_bootloader.php
Guida alla Programmazione ATmega328 noP:
http://www.michelemenniti.it/atmega328nop.html
Articoli su Elettronica In:
http://www.michelemenniti.it/elettronica_in.html

Offline Offline
Sr. Member
****
Karma: 2
Posts: 466
View Profile
 Bigger Bigger  Smaller Smaller  Reset Reset

Bene, però il mio è un 644 stand alone  smiley-twist
Ho visto dal datas. che per il 644P a 20MHz le tensioni Min e Max sono "20 MHz @ 4.5V - 5.5V"
Per cui ci sono abbastanza stretto.. ma ripeto.. sarà sempre comunque collegato alla Vin... per cui non penso d' avere problemi...
Comunque non vi nascondo che il circuito con l' op. e mosfet mi incuriosisce lo stesso.  smiley-mr-green
Logged

Lamezia Terme
Offline Offline
Shannon Member
****
Karma: 386
Posts: 10281
Le domande di chi vuol imparare rappresentano la sua sete di sapere
View Profile
WWW
 Bigger Bigger  Smaller Smaller  Reset Reset

Non devi guardare quella voce, ma il grafico che ti ho detto, trovalo anche sul 644 (pag. 335) e vedrai che sono molto simili, per cui anche nel tuo caso puoi lavorare tranquillamente a 4V circa, quindi no problem....
Logged

Guida alla programmazione ISP e seriale dei micro ATMEL (Caricare bootloader e sketch):
http://www.michelemenniti.it/Arduino_burn_bootloader.php
Guida alla Programmazione ATmega328 noP:
http://www.michelemenniti.it/atmega328nop.html
Articoli su Elettronica In:
http://www.michelemenniti.it/elettronica_in.html

Offline Offline
Sr. Member
****
Karma: 2
Posts: 466
View Profile
 Bigger Bigger  Smaller Smaller  Reset Reset

Certamente, il grafico è molto più chiaro..
Dopo che avrò collegato tutto farò una prova e vediamo sotto carico (per curiosità) quanto arriva.
Ma sicuramente non sarà un problema.  smiley-wink
Logged

Offline Offline
Sr. Member
****
Karma: 2
Posts: 466
View Profile
 Bigger Bigger  Smaller Smaller  Reset Reset

Ciao.. riprendo un attimo questo topic, perchè sto facendo delle prove con il tlc2262I e un p-mosfet irf9540.
Con una Vin di 12v ho in uscita dal tlc2262 (quindi nel gate del mosfet) circa 3,4v e quando collego Vin il mosfet continua a condurre la tensione usb.
Nel tlc sono comparate le tensioni 3.3v e 5.7v che quest' ultima arriva dal partitore.
Sembra che la tensione nel gate sia troppo poca per per portare in H il mosfet. Forse è sbagliato il modello del mosfet ? il 9540 è troppo grande ?

La soluzione diodo va benissimo, ma volevo provare anche questa soluzione. Solo per didattica.
« Last Edit: February 14, 2013, 03:41:27 am by superzaffo » Logged

Pages: 1 [2]   Go Up
Print
 
Jump to: